Study of efficacy and safety of KSM-66 Ashwagandhaa (Withania somnifera Dunal) in stress and anxiety and on general well being in healthy adults.

A Single Centre, Prospective, Randomized, Double-blind Placebo Controlled Study of Safety And Efficacy of KSM-66 in Healthy Adults.

Interventions

Intervention1: ksm66 ashwagandhaa: 250 mg orally BID for 8 weeks Control Intervention1: Placebo: same

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: ? Healthy adults of either sex, who are facing routine work stresses, who sign the Informed Consent Form. ? Age group 18 -54 years ? Can read , write and understand English ? Subjects with WHO-5 well being index < 15 or PSS scores >14

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: ? Suffering from any chronic physical, hormonal or psychiatric illness ? Current substance dependence ? Individuals refusing to use appropriate non-hormonal birth control measures. ? Pregnancy / lactating mothers ? Currently taking any other medication on a regular basis ? Currently taking any herbal preparations (other formulations containing ashwagandha / ginseng / ginkgo biloba / brahmi etc) ? Clinically significant findings on laboratory investigations and ECG

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Total score on DASS and GHQ-28 after 8 wkTimepoint: 0 day, 60 day

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Comparison of the study and control group on PSS scores Comparison of the study and control groups on various laboratory measures and serum cortisol levels Comparison of the study and control group on PSS scores Comparison of the study and control groups on various laboratory measures and serum cortisol levels Timepoint: 0 day and 60 day
